António Folha took over the secondary team.

Rui Barros left the technical command of FC Porto B, but he does not leave the club, especially because his work and personality have always been highly admired by SAD.

According to what THE GAME learned, the former player will remain in the Blue and Whites’ structure, where he has been working since he left the lawns, but it only remains to define for sure in which functions he will do it.

Rui Barros came to FC Porto almost 40 years ago to play in the junior category. As a player he spent seven seasons and won, among other things, six championships, an Intercontinental Cup and a European Super Cup, in which he was decisive. Hanging up his boots, Rui Barros was an assistant between 2005 and 2017, also assuming the role of observer. In 2018/19 he became head coach of team B until Monday.
